WIRELESS SECURITY

Setting up  a wireless router is fairly easy if you follow the instruction that come with the device. Still, if you're not confident about setting up a router, take the help of a techie friend, or your internet service provider.

PASSWORD PROTECTION

You wouldn't want anybody to mooch off your internet connection.Restrict access to your network by using WPA2 encryption and changing the default router password.

PREVENT MISUSE

You can also protect your network from misuse with the help of parental controls and bandwidth monitoring tools.

GUEST LOGIN

Create an alternative login for guests. It's safer and smarter.

FIREWALL

Some routers include a firewall, providing blanket protection to all the devices on the network from possible hack attacks.
